Japanese winger Takefusa Kubo is going through one of the most challenging periods since joining Real Sociedad.

After renewing his contract in February 2024 until 2029, the player was expecting an ambitious project that would allow him to continue growing. However, what he found was a scenario very different from what was promised.

The Japanese footballer feels deceived by a board that assured him of a reinforced squad with European ambitions, yet failed to make any significant signings. His frustration grows week by week with a team that seems to have lost its competitive edge.

Takefusa Kubo and Real Sociedad's Unfulfilled Promise

When Takefusa Kubo decided to extend his ties with Real Sociedad, he did so convinced that the club would take a step forward in its aspirations. The president, Jokin Aperribay, talked to him about a solid project, reinforcements that would elevate the squad's level, and a commitment to compete among LaLiga's elite.

However, the reality has been different. The transfer market ended without any notable additions, the team lost its solidity, and results have not been forthcoming. The Japanese player is beginning to notice that the lack of internal competition is diminishing his motivation, and the athletic commitment promised to him has not materialized.

A Club Lacking Ambition and an Environment that Wears on Takefusa Kubo

Beyond the sporting aspect, Takefusa Kubo has also lost confidence in the club's technical structure. He believes the current coach lacks the necessary experience in LaLiga to extract the maximum potential from the squad. Additionally, he is critical of the medical staff, whom he perceives as inadequately equipped to handle injuries and recoveries reliably.

Sources close to the player affirm that the lack of planning and passivity in the sports management are factors that have led him to reconsider his continuity. A sense of disappointment is palpable in the locker room, and Kubo, who is one of the technical leaders of the group, is beginning to feel the burden of carrying a team that is not delivering on the field.

Real Sociedad, on its part, remains confident in turning the situation around, although hints from the player's circle suggest that his patience is wearing thin. The club cannot freely make signings due to financial constraints, complicating any attempts at immediate improvement.

The World Cup, Takefusa Kubo's Last Great Motivation

Despite everything, Takefusa Kubo tries to maintain motivation by focusing on his major personal goal: arriving in peak condition for the upcoming World Cup with the Japanese national team. The attacker sees this tournament as the perfect opportunity to showcase his level and rediscover joy in football.

The Japanese player continues to train intensively and stands out in Real Sociedad's matches, but his body language reflects fatigue. Within the club, it is acknowledged that his spirit is not the same as last year, and his involvement has decreased since he perceived the institutional lack of ambition.

With a contract running until 2029, Kubo remains professionally committed, though his future may hinge on whether the board ultimately fulfills the promises made. Otherwise, it would not be surprising if in the upcoming transfer window his name once again becomes one of the most sought-after players in Europe.

The situation of Takefusa Kubo in Real Sociedad reflects the dilemma of a talent unwilling to resign to mediocrity. Time will tell whether the club reacts or if the Japanese player seeks new horizons to reignite lost enthusiasm.
